    This is actually planned. Barbed wire models are being made along with sandbags. I plan on making the over top route hard between trenches, forcing more trench fighting. That is what the map is suffering from in current playtests, people having free roam up top and down below. There will also be Tank Turret bunkers and callable arty back from the fortress now located on each side.

    There will be 1 flag per trench network, and 1 back near the fort so 5 flags total and cutting down on the utter grind fest along with sandbags and obstacles in the trenches for cover. The only way to get around will be through the outside forest which can be defended against.

    Ah. That is going to be the usable tank turret mounted to the bunker.

    [​IMG]

    It's taken from this. It was the Pantherturm in use by the Germans in WW2 when they had more turrets than chassis available, so they put them on bunkers and had the loading mechanism down in the bunker.
